Choghadiya - Madurai, 4 March 2026

On Wednesday, the 4th of March 2026, the Vedic calendar for those in Madurai carries a day of particular rhythmic quality. The morning light begins at 6:31 AM and dipping below the horizon at 6:27 PM, bringing 11 hours 56 minutes of daylight. The tithi is Pratipada of the Krishna fortnight, and the nakshatra of the day is Purva Phalguni. Yoga for the day is Dhriti, completing the core panchang signature for 2026-03-04. Pre-dawn, from 4:55 AM to 5:43 AM, is Brahma Muhurta: the period the Vedic tradition reserves for prayer, meditation, and study.

For those in Madurai, From 12:29 PM to 1:58 PM Rahu Kala is in force — the period to avoid for new endeavours. On Wednesday the Disha Shool (directional affliction) is North; the classical recommendation is to delay North-facing departures. On the auspicious side, Labh (6:31 AM–8:00 AM) is the top-quality choghadiya of the day. Purva Phalguni nakshatra is governed by Venus, grounding the cosmic calendar in the rhythms of this specific place and time.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Rahu Kaal in Madurai on 4 March 2026?
In Madurai on 4 March 2026, Rahu Kaal runs from 12:29 PM to 1:58 PM. This 90-minute window is governed by Rahu and is traditionally avoided for starting new work, travel, or auspicious ceremonies. The timing shifts daily based on local sunrise, so it differs from city to city.
Why is sunrise in Madurai on 4 March 2026 at 6:31 AM?
Sunrise at 6:31 AM in Madurai on 4 March 2026 is determined by the city's geographic latitude (9.93°N) and the Earth's axial tilt on this date. The exact sunrise and sunset (6:27 PM) define the length of the Vedic day and anchor all panchang calculations — from Rahu Kaal to the choghadiya slots — to Madurai's local horizon.
What yoga is operative in Madurai on 4 March 2026?
The yoga operative in Madurai on 4 March 2026 is Dhriti, active from 10:24 AM to 8:52 AM local time. In the Vedic panchang, yoga is calculated from the combined longitudes of the Sun and Moon and cycles through 27 named yogas. Dhriti yoga carries its own quality and influences the day's overall character — affecting the auspiciousness of activities begun during its span.
